*Chapter Nine — Fasla*

*(Distance)*

He had told the airline he'd extend by a day before he'd told his mother. This felt, in retrospect, like the wrong order of operations — but his mother, when he finally mentioned it over breakfast Tuesday morning, simply nodded and said, "I'll make *kothimbir vadi* tonight," as though this had been the plan all along, as though mothers possess some early-warning system that renders announcements redundant.
